Reporting Serious Concerns
This platform is intended for sharing experiences and promoting awareness. It is not a substitute for reporting serious safety concerns to the appropriate authorities.
If you believe a child is in immediate danger, please call 911.
To report concerns about a childcare facility:
- Michigan: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s (LARA) - (866) 685-0006
- National: Childhelp National Child Abuse Hotline - 1-800-422-4453
- Contact your state's childcare licensing agency
